Couples Work: Through the Lens of The Penny Model Workshop with Stefan Charidge

I believe that couples and family work is about supporting two or more people to feel heard and understood.


When this doesn’t happen, we experience rupture, conflict, and isolation.


Therapy helps people speak the unspoken and express the unexpressed, building deeper intimacy — IN-TO-ME-SEE.


At the heart of this work lies fear, often rooted in historical trauma or limiting beliefs that have been hidden, denied, or suppressed.


This session and these tools support you in resolving differences and ruptures by helping clients own and share the core emotion of sadness — the emotional space where grief, addictions, depression, and love reside — through the exploration and ownership of all core emotions.


We all want to connect, but fear, introjects, and limiting beliefs can block that connection, often leading to the very rupture or separation we wish to avoid.


You will gain two main sets of tools to help with these dynamics — at home, at work, and in the therapy room.
